About Kalsubai Peak Trek:

The Kalsubai Trek is an exciting, rewarding, and beautiful journey through the Sahyadri mountains that leads you to their highest point. The trail offers varied terrain such as flat paths, steep ascents, rocky patches, as well as sections equipped with iron ladders to further add complexity to this hike, making this trek highly attractive to adventurers and thrill-seekers. From Kalsubai's peak, you can enjoy breathtaking scenic views of the majestic Sahyadri range. Famous fort peaks such as Alang Madan Kulang, Ratangad and Ajoba can all be seen clearly; many experienced trekkers combine multiple treks on their itinerary for added thrill and excitement. On the summit of a peak is a temple dedicated to Kalsubai Devi. According to legend, she lived amongst the mountains and selflessly provided help and shelter to both villagers and animals alike. The temple attracts many pilgrims during Navratri when special prayers and cultural events take place there. Trekking up Kalsubai's summit can be enjoyed throughout the year. However, the monsoon season offers particularly stunning experiences. Water falls and mist-covered trails make the journey all the more pleasurable, although in places it may become slippery and hazardous. Winter offers the best conditions for visiting the Kalsubai trek as the weather makes inclined climbing less exhausting.

Blog - Kalsubai: A Quick Guide

If you're an adventure seeker looking for an exciting trekking experience, the Kalsubai Trek is a must-do! Known as the Everest of Maharashtra, this trek takes you to the highest peak in the state, offering breathtaking views, a thrilling climb, and a spiritually significant temple at the summit.

Location and Height

Kalsubai Peak stands at 1,646 meters (5,400 feet) above sea level, making it the highest point in Maharashtra. It is located in the Western Ghats, within the Kalsubai Harishchandragad Wildlife Sanctuary.

Cultural Significance

The peak is named after Goddess Kalsubai, and there's a small temple dedicated to her at the summit. Many devotees trek up to seek blessings, especially during festivals.

Best Time to Visit Kalsubai

The best time to trek Kalsubai depends on the experience you're looking for:

  • Winter (October–February): Best for clear views and cool weather.

  • Monsoon (June–September): Ideal for greenery and waterfalls, but the trail is slippery.

  • Summer (March-May): Avoid, as it gets too hot.

How to Reach Kalsubai

From Mumbai:

  • Take a train to Igatpuri or Kasara, then a local bus or cab to Bari village.

  • Driving from Mumbai takes around 4–5 hours.

From Pune:

  • Take a train to Igatpuri, then a bus or cab.

  • A direct drive takes 5–6 hours.

Nearest Railway Station:

  • Igatpuri Railway Station (about 35 km from the base).

Kalsubai Trek Route Options

Via Bari Village (Most Popular Route)

  • Starts from Bari Village, about a 6 km trek.

  • Well-marked trail with steel ladders in steep sections.

Alternative Routes

  • From Indore Village (less crowded, slightly difficult).

  • From Udvade Village (scenic, but longer route).

Difficulty Level and Trek Duration

  • Difficulty: Moderate

  • Trek Duration: 3–4 hours to the top, 2–3 hours to descend.

  • Suitable for beginners but requires good stamina.

Things to Carry for Kalsubai Trek

  • Trekking shoes with a good grip.

  • 2–3 litres of water to stay hydrated.

  • Energy snacks like dry fruits and protein bars.

  • Raincoat or poncho (during monsoons).

  • Torch with extra batteries (if trekking at night).

Flora and Fauna on the Trek

  • Lush green landscapes in monsoons.

  • Spot birds, butterflies, and small reptiles.

  • Wildflowers bloom during winter.

Key Attractions on Kalsubai Trek

  • Kalsubai Temple at the summit.

  • Steel ladders for steep climbs.

  • 360-degree panoramic views of the Sahyadris.

Camping at Kalsubai

  • Camping is allowed at the base and midway.

  • Best spots: Bari village or near the summit.

Safety Tips for the Trek

  • Start early to avoid trekking in the dark.

  • Be cautious on slippery paths, especially in the monsoon.

  • Follow marked trails to avoid getting lost.

Food and Accommodation

  • Food stalls are available at the base and along the route.

  • Stay options: Homestays in Bari village or campsites.

Photography Opportunities

  • Sunrise and sunset views from the peak.

  • Stunning cloud-covered landscapes during the monsoon.

Local Legends and Myths

The legend says Kalsubai was a young girl who lived in the region and later disappeared mysteriously. Locals built a temple in her memory, which is now a pilgrimage site.
